The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network (RAINN) is a crucial resource dedicated to providing comfort and advocacy for survivors of sexual violence. RAINN's qualified staff members are available 24/7 to offer confidential support through their toll-free hotline at 1-800-656-HOPE.

Additionally, RAINN's website, https://www.rainn.org, offers a wealth of information for survivors, loved ones, and the general public. The website provides support on various topics related to sexual assault, including self-care techniques.
